African Violets: A Velvet Touch of Beauty in Your Home
Nestled amidst the world of indoor plants, African violets emerge as exquisite gems of beauty and charm. With their velvety, heart-shaped leaves and a captivating array of colors, they have captivated plant enthusiasts for decades.
African violets belong to the Gesneriaceae family, distinguished by their remarkably uniform appearance. Their leaves form a graceful rosette, showcasing a vibrant tapestry of green, sometimes adorned with intricate patterns or subtle variegations. Each leaf exudes a soft, velvety texture that adds a touch of elegance to any space.
The beauty of African violets extends beyond their foliage. Their blooms, held aloft on slender stems, resemble miniature masterpieces. The delicate petals display a kaleidoscope of colors, from soft pastels to vibrant purples and crimsons. Blooms can be single or double, ruffled or frilly, each adding a unique touch of charm to the plant.
Taxonomy and Classification: Unveiling the Lineage of African Violets
In the realm of botany, the African violet finds its place within the esteemed Gesneriaceae family. Distinguished by their velvety leaves and enchanting blooms, African violets belong to the genus Saintpaulia, a botanical haven named in honor of Baron Walter von Saint Paul-Illaire, a 19th-century Austrian aristocrat. Interestingly, the genus Saintpaulia is closely related to other horticultural gems, such as Streptocarpus, Columnea, and Episcia. These kindred spirits share similar characteristics that evoke the irresistible charm of African violets.

Closely Related Genera
African violets are not isolated in their family, the Gesneriaceae. They have closely related genera that share similar characteristics and are often confused with African violets. Let’s explore two such genera: Streptocarpus and Columnea/Episcia.
Streptocarpus
Streptocarpus is a genus of flowering plants in the Gesneriaceae family. Like African violets, they have velvety leaves and produce beautiful blooms. However, there are key differences between the two genera.
- Leaves: Streptocarpus leaves are generally larger and more elongated than African violet leaves. They also have a more pronounced petiole or leaf stalk.
- Flowers: Streptocarpus flowers are typically larger and more trumpet-shaped than African violet flowers. They come in a wide range of colors, including blue, pink, purple, and white.
- Growth habit: Streptocarpus plants tend to be more upright and sprawling than African violets. They often produce runners that form new plants.
Columnea and Episcia
Columnea and Episcia are two closely related genera that are often grouped together. They are both native to Central and South America and have similar growth habits and care requirements.
- Leaves: Columnea and Episcia have velvety leaves that are often variegated or patterned. Columnea leaves are typically smaller and more elongated than Episcia leaves.
- Flowers: Columnea and Episcia flowers are small and tubular, often with bright colors and contrasting markings. They are produced on long, trailing stems.
- Growth habit: Columnea plants are typically trailing or vining, while Episcia plants are more compact and bushy.
Despite their differences, Streptocarpus, Columnea, and Episcia all belong to the Gesneriaceae family and share many similarities. They are all easy to grow and make excellent houseplants, providing a touch of beauty and tropical flair to any home.

Practical Guidance for African Violet Care
Cultivating African violets is a rewarding endeavor, but it requires proper care to ensure thriving plants. Watering: Water your plants thoroughly when the soil feels dry to the touch, but avoid overwatering, as this can lead to root rot.
Fertilization: Fertilize your African violets regularly with a balanced, diluted liquid fertilizer. This will provide them with the essential nutrients they need for healthy growth and abundant blooms.
Repotting: As African violets mature, they will need to be repotted into larger containers. Use a well-draining African violet potting mix and choose a pot with drainage holes to prevent waterlogging.

Leaf Cuttings: A Simple Yet Effective Method
The most common method for propagating African violets is through leaf cuttings. Select healthy, mature leaves from the mother plant and carefully remove them with a sharp, clean knife or scissors. Remove the petiole (the leaf stem) about 2 inches from the base of the leaf.
Next, prepare a well-draining potting mix consisting of perlite or vermiculite mixed with a small amount of peat moss or potting soil. Dip the cut end of the petiole into rooting hormone to encourage root development, then insert it about 1 inch deep into the potting mix. Keep the soil moist but not soggy, and provide bright, indirect light.
Division: A Quick and Convenient Option
If your African violet has grown into a large, mature plant with multiple crowns (growing points), you can propagate it through division. Carefully remove the plant from its pot and gently separate the crowns with your fingers or a sharp knife. Repot each crown into its own pot filled with fresh potting mix.
Ensure that each crown has its own roots, or else it may not survive. Water the newly divided plants well and place them in a warm, humid location until they establish new roots.
Tips for Successful Propagation
- Use sterile tools to prevent the spread of disease.
- Keep the propagation area warm (65-75°F) and humid.
- Avoid overwatering, as this can lead to root rot.
- Provide bright, indirect light to encourage growth and prevent stretching.
- Be patient, as African violets can take several weeks or months to develop roots and new plants.
Pest and Disease Management: Keeping Your African Violets Thriving
While African violets are generally low-maintenance plants, they can still be susceptible to certain pests and diseases. By understanding the potential threats and implementing effective management strategies, you can ensure that your African violets remain healthy and vibrant.
Common Pests:
- Aphids: These tiny, soft-bodied insects feed on the sap of African violets, causing yellowed leaves and stunted growth.
- Mealybugs: These small, white insects produce a cottony substance on the leaves and stems, draining the plant of nutrients.
- Spider mites: These microscopic mites cause stippling and yellowing of the leaves, eventually leading to leaf drop.
Common Diseases:
- Crown rot: This fungal disease causes the crown of the plant to rot, leading to wilting and eventual death.
- Powdery mildew: This fungal disease appears as a white powdery substance on the leaves, blocking photosynthesis and stunting growth.
- Botrytis blight: This fungal disease causes brown spots on the leaves and stems, leading to decay.
Management Strategies:
Prevention:
- Quarantine new plants: Inspect new plants before introducing them to your existing collection to prevent the introduction of pests or diseases.
- Maintain proper hygiene: Regularly clean tools and pots used for African violets to prevent cross-contamination.
- Encourage air circulation: Good air flow around your plants helps prevent the buildup of moisture, which can attract pests and diseases.
Control:
- Insecticidal soap: For aphids, mealybugs, and spider mites, use an insecticidal soap solution to kill the insects without harming the plant.
- Neem oil: This natural pesticide has both insecticidal and fungicidal properties, making it effective against a wide range of pests and diseases.
- Fungicides: For crown rot, powdery mildew, and botrytis blight, use specific fungicides designed for African violets to prevent or control the spread of the disease.
- Handpicking: If the infestation is small, manually remove pests such as aphids or mealybugs using a damp cloth or cotton swab dipped in rubbing alcohol.
Remember, timely detection and prompt treatment are crucial to protect your African violets from pests and diseases. By implementing these management strategies, you can enjoy the beauty and vitality of these charming plants for years to come.
